Output 612e84640cac5d37019df127e4d8cc3eddf3898338f277660179577b937a08e5:6

value
42747627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2aeaccffc39e46275b8f73e7f15832149d8026 OP_EQUAL
address
MSRQpJxZxtaxd7RUvMhSVJSNLbooxjEkCV
transaction
612e84640cac5d37019df127e4d8cc3eddf3898338f277660179577b937a08e5
spent
true